Aamir Khan may today be seen as a symbol of excellence and consistency in Hindi cinema, but behind the stardom lies a chapter of self-doubt, missteps, and emotional turmoil. The superstar recently opened up about the difficult period that nearly derailed his career before his rise to iconic status.
Speaking at the Hindustan Times Leadership Summit 2025, the actor candidly recalled the period when he feared his career was 'going down the drain.'
‘I Am Not Built to Do 2–3 Films Together’
In conversation with Sonal Kalra, Chief Managing Editor – Entertainment and Lifestyle, Hindustan Times, Aamir shared that QSQT made him an overnight star, but the acclaim did not translate into offers from the directors he hoped to work with. Feeling pressured to establish himself, he signed 8–9 films in quick succession, thinking this was modest compared to peers doing 30–40 films.
However, once shooting began, he realised his mistake. “I am not built to do 2–3 films together,” he said, adding that his creative sensibilities did not align with the teams he was working with.

‘One Film Wonder’ Tag and Emotional Turmoil
When the films released and flopped one after another, Aamir was labelled a “one-film wonder” a tag he admits was justified. Worse, he still had unreleased films that he felt were equally poor. “I used to come home and cry. I felt my career was over,” he said.
Reinventing Himself and Rising Again
Determined never to compromise again, Aamir rebuilt his journey with hits like Dil, Raja Hindustani, Sarfarosh, and later, all-time blockbusters such as Ghajini, 3 Idiots, PK, and Dangal. His recent release, Sitaare Zameen Par, crossed Rs 200 crore worldwide before premiering on YouTube.
Aamir’s reflections highlight a powerful truth: even the most celebrated actors face moments of doubt. His commitment to quality storytelling turned early setbacks into one of Bollywood’s most inspiring comebacks.
